Fan Sounds Off About the Boss
- Share via
Thank you! Thank you! to Roy Rivenburg (‘Off-Kilter” column, Oct. 29) for setting the record straight on the horrific acoustics in the top tiers of the new Staples Center. After plunking down $135 per seat to see Bruce Springsteen for the first time in my long fandom, I can only say that it was by far the best rock performance I never experienced. The sound was awful. Everybody down there on the floor, and even in the first tier, seemed to be having a peak experience. Not so we denizens of the Upper Reaches. It was like he was singing under water.
It was exasperating enough when Bruce said it sounded great to him, but I was furious when Robert Hilburn wrote the next day that the sound was terrific. Please, Robert, the next time you cover a concert there, you ought to climb on up to the People’s Seats.
So again, kudos to Rivenburg for validating what thousands experienced (or rather didn’t). It soothed my disappointed soul.
--JOAN DEPEW
Pasadena
